Rooted in the great American folk vein, but dowsed with heartfelt absurdism, crafty lyrics, and a classical lean. Lots of male-female harmony, cello, piano, blues harmonica, bells, choirs, chickens, checkout aisle beeps turned into an EKG machine, etc.

About Nate and Kate:
Nate and Kate were both born and raised in rural upstate NY. At 16 or so Nate learned to sing and play guitar with the local church choir. He began writing songs and has now written over a hundred original songs. He also released 2 1/2 solo albums before “Nate and Kate” was born. He now also performs as a professional juggler on the side and can balance an upright bass on his face. Kate grew up singing and playing cello from the age of 4. She has performed in numerous orchestras, string ensembles, and choirs through grade school and college including singing is some of Italy’s most magnificent cathedrals as well as New York’s Avery Fischer Hall with the Hamilton College Choir. She and Nate met and began playing together in Binghamton in early 2005 and toured the mid-west in Fall ’05. Their act has been many times called “awesome” and “unpredictable,” and has been well-received in unfamiliar places. Nate and Kate are excited to be now based in Ithaca, NY and look forward to playing locally as well as returning to the road.
